Abstract
Severe wear mechanisms in Al2O3-AlON ceramic composites during their friction against a bearing steel were investigated and analysed by different techniques, mainly transmission electron microscopy (TEM). It was shown that ceramic damages correspond not to a classical intergranular cracking but to a breakdown of alumina–alumina grain boundaries leading to their pull off. Consequently, a new model of the severe wear of ceramics, based on a dielectric approach is proposed. Moreover, the existence of AlON located at such boundaries induces a delaying effect of this damage and seems to participate in the forming and the stability in the contact of a third body essentially constituted by iron oxides.
